Course details

Effective Communication in Employee Relations: Understanding the importance of clear and respectful communication between employers and employees, managing conflicts, and promoting positive work environments.
Legal Aspects of Employee Relations: Overview of labor laws, regulations, and compliance, including anti-discrimination laws, workplace safety, and employee privacy rights.
Employee Engagement and Retention Strategies: Techniques to enhance employee satisfaction, motivation, and productivity, leading to higher retention rates and long-term organizational success.
Performance Management and Development: Implementing performance evaluation systems, setting achievable goals, providing constructive feedback, and identifying opportunities for growth and development.
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ion in the Workplace: Fostering a work environment that values and respects the unique backgrounds, experiences, and perspectives of all employees, promoting equal opportunities and reducing bias.
Collective Bargaining and Labor Relations: Understanding the principles, processes, and best practices of negotiating and maintaining positive relationships with labor unions and employee representatives.
Compensation and Benefits Management: Designing and administering fair and competitive compensation and benefits packages, ensuring internal equity and external market competitiveness.
Workplace Investigations and Compliance: Conducting thorough and objective investigations of employee complaints and grievances, ensuring compliance with relevant laws, regulations, and company policies.
Change Management and Transition Planning: Developing and implementing effective strategies to manage and communicate organizational changes, minimizing resistance, and ensuring a smooth transition for all stakeholders.
